Abbey House Residential Homes-Morden is a twelve-bedroom accommodation that is ideal for elderly people and also for challenging mental health issues, such as dementia and stroke care.

Residents experience an efficient and professional service thanks to highly-qualified carers, in a spacious interior that is suited to wheelchair users and complete with many homely comforts.

All aspects of health, hygiene and nutrition are treated as crucial parts of a successful service, while a stimulating daily environment is also a permanent aim of the service.

Overall Experience  Overall Experience 4.0 out of 5

The home is well-managed, and the manager is very kind and friendly. Some of the carers speak very little English which can sometimes be a problem. The home is a bit old and can be a bit updated. The food is always a critical issue. Fresh cooked food is always preferable, so having a cook may be a good
idea though the taste in food varies a lot. Some are fussy and will eat only very good food, others don’t mind.
I liked the dining room but not the sitting room with the TV which is small and annoying. Would be good to think of some activities that residents can do together - like exercises, playing games together like chess, cards, backgammon, etc. More activities that engage the residents' brains and encourage communication with each other will be recommendable, not just sitting in front of the TV like zombies. But in general, the home is trying to provide good care and comfort. Thank you!

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  • a) 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months.

    The Average Rating of 4.648 for Abbey House - Morden is calculated as follows: ( (38 Excellents x 5) + (14 Goods x 4) + (1 Satisfactorys x 3) + (1 Poors x 2) ) ÷ 54 Ratings = 4.648

  • b) 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5').

    The 4.5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Abbey House - Morden is based on 5 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    • i) 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 = 3.5

    • ii) 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 12 registered maximum number of service users is 2.4, which has been reached with 5 Positive reviews. Points = 1

  • When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.

  • If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
